Unity3D引领网页游戏新纪元,从制作到体验的全面解析
在数字娱乐的浪潮中,Unity3D引擎以其强大的跨平台特性和丰富的游戏开发资源,成为了网页游戏制作的首选工具,就让我们一起走进Unity3D的世界,探索如何利用这一神奇引擎制作出令人心动的网页游戏。
一、Unity3D的魅力何在?
Unity3D是一款集成了众多先进技术的游戏开发引擎,它不仅支持多种平台,包括网页、PC、移动端等,还提供了丰富的开发工具和资源,使得开发者能够快速上手并制作出高质量的游戏,对于网页游戏而言,Unity3D的轻量级特性和高效的渲染技术,使得游戏在各种网络环境下都能流畅运行。
二、Unity3D网页游戏制作流程
1、确定游戏概念与需求
在开始制作之前,要明确游戏的概念和需求,这包括游戏的类型、玩法、美术风格等,通过市场调研和用户需求分析,为游戏定位并设定目标群体。
2、场景与角色建模
利用Unity3D的建模工具或导入第三方建模软件制作的资产,开始构建游戏的世界,这包括地形、建筑、植被等场景元素的创建,以及角色、道具等模型的制作。
3、编写脚本与逻辑
Unity3D支持C#和JavaScript等多种脚本语言,开发者可以根据需求编写游戏的逻辑和交互,这包括角色的行为控制、游戏的进程推动、用户界面的设计等。
4、添加特效与音效
通过Unity3D的特效系统,为游戏添加各种视觉效果,如粒子效果、光影渲染等,添加背景音乐和音效,增强游戏的氛围和体验。
5、测试与优化
在完成基本制作后,进行游戏的测试和优化,这包括性能测试、兼容性测试、用户体验测试等,确保游戏在各种环境下都能稳定运行并给玩家带来良好的体验。
6、发布与运营
将游戏发布到网页或其他平台,并进行后续的运营和维护,这包括更新内容、修复bug、推广宣传等,以保持游戏的活力和吸引力。
三、Unity3D网页游戏的体验优势
使用Unity3D制作的网页游戏,具有画面精美、交互性强、跨平台运行等优势,玩家无需下载安装,即可在各种设备上畅享游戏乐趣,Unity3D还提供了丰富的社交功能,使得玩家之间能够轻松互动和交流。
四、结语
Unity3D作为一款强大的游戏开发引擎,为网页游戏的制作提供了无限可能,通过合理的制作流程和精心的设计,我们可以制作出画面精美、玩法丰富的网页游戏,为玩家带来前所未有的游戏体验,随着技术的不断进步和市场的不断发展,Unity3D将会引领网页游戏进入一个全新的纪元。